/* See LICENSE file for copyright and license details. */
#include "lib-common.h"


enum libcharconv_result
libcharconv_yijing_digrams(const char *s, size_t slen, size_t *n, uint_least32_t *cp, size_t *ncp)
{
	uint_least32_t c;
	*n = 0;
	for (; slen--; s++) {
		if ('1' <= s[0] && s[0] <= '3') {
			if (!slen)
				return LIBCHARCONV_INDETERMINATE;
			if      (s[0] == '1' && s[1] == '1') c = UINT32_C(0x268C);
			else if (s[0] == '1' && s[1] == '2') c = UINT32_C(0x268E);
			else if (s[0] == '1' && s[1] == '3') c = UINT32_C(0x1D301);
			else if (s[0] == '2' && s[1] == '1') c = UINT32_C(0x268D);
			else if (s[0] == '2' && s[1] == '2') c = UINT32_C(0x268F);
			else if (s[0] == '2' && s[1] == '3') c = UINT32_C(0x1D302);
			else if (s[0] == '3' && s[1] == '1') c = UINT32_C(0x1D303);
			else if (s[0] == '3' && s[1] == '2') c = UINT32_C(0x1D304);
			else if (s[0] == '3' && s[1] == '3') c = UINT32_C(0x1D305);
			else
				goto no_match;
			goto conv;
		} else {
		no_match:
			*n += 1u;
		}
	}
no_conv:
	return LIBCHARCONV_NO_CONVERT;

conv:
	if (*n)
		goto no_conv;
	if (*ncp)
		*cp = c;
	*n += 2u;
	*ncp = 1u;
	return LIBCHARCONV_CONVERTED;
}
